What is the cheapest month to fly from San José to Salt Lake City?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from San José to Salt Lake City,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from San José to Salt Lake City is June, where tickets cost $463 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and February,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$737 and $653 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from San José to Salt Lake City?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from San José to Salt Lake City,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from San José to Salt Lake City, you should book around 8 weeks before departure, which saves you about 7%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 22 weeks before departure.
